Meilleure pratique / style pour importer une police dans une application Web angulaire de 4 cli

Je travaille sur un Angulaires 4 projet personnel, et je voulais ajouter Ubuntu famille de polices à mon Angulaire de l'application. Quelle est la meilleure pratique ou de style pour l'ajout d'un certain nombre de polices personnalisées à un projet? J'ai actuellement enregistré le ubuntu famille de polices dans /actif/fonts/ubuntu-font-family-0,83 et de l'ajouter à la plus externe de la composante fichier CSS, app.composante.css avec la police.

@font-face {
   font-family: 'Ubuntu';
   src: url('/assets/fonts/ubuntu-font-family-0.83/Ubuntu-R.ttf');
}

Par la mise en au composant d'origine je n'ai pas à redéfinir la police dans les composants imbriqués j'ai juste le traiter comme une police par défaut de la famille.

Est-il plus clair/meilleure façon de le faire et encore découper le code dupliqué?

source d'informationauteur ob1